The 2015 appeared in Vintages (**/**+) with 88.5-points on February 3, 2018 at $16.95 and was Recommended. Here is my previous note: Extremely deep intense purple colour. Intense, spicy, cedary, crancherry-plum nose. Dry, medium bodied, tangy, plummy, ripe cherry-plum flavours with a lingering, spicy, cedary, harmonious,licorice-tinged finish. This 14% alcohol blend of Malbec, Bonarda and Syrah has 4 g/L residual sugar with lot number L34792-3 2017/07/12 on the back label. CSPC 37036

TASTING NOTE: A blend of vineyards in Uco and Luján de Cuyo, there's 70% malbec, 20% bonarda, and 10% syrah in this wine. The style has changed from its first vintage in 2005, and now, instead of voluptuousness and ripeness, it's focused on linearity, freshness, and underscoring its red fruit through less oak and earlier harvests. This is delicious red fruit juice with herbs and an accent on the acidity and its firm, fierce tannins. Score - 91 (Patricio Tapia, Descorchados, 2018) Price $ 16.95
